In-Motion Charging Trolleys in Revolutionizing Bus Rapid Transit Systems
VirtualAs cities seek scalable, zero-emission transit options, in-motion charging (IMC) is emerging as a groundbreaking solution—enabling electric buses to recharge continuously while operating along fixed routes. This session, led by Mohammad Kharouf, P.Eng., MASc, Senior Manager of Research & Integration at CUTRIC, explores how IMC trolleys are transforming the way bus rapid transit (BRT) systems function. From reduced battery size and cost, to increased operational uptime and route flexibility, in-motion charging offers cities a path to electrification without compromising service reliability. Mohammad will unpack real-world implementations, technical configurations, and how this model integrates with existing transit infrastructure. Attendees will learn: How IMC reduces depot charging needs and supports continuous operations Infrastructure requirements and considerations for deployment The benefits of trolleybus-style electrification adapted for modern BRT How IMC contributes to long-term sustainability and cost-effectiveness in transit Don’t miss this deep dive into one of the most efficient paths toward zero-emission mobility in urban centers.

Okotoks
VirtualAs small and mid-sized municipalities seek to transition to zero-emission transit, feasibility studies become a crucial tool for assessing technical, financial, and operational readiness. This session provides an in-depth look at the Town of Okotoks’ zero-emission transit feasibility study, offering a blueprint for other communities across Canada. Led by Alexis Dunphy, Project Manager at CUTRIC, the session will explore how the study evaluated Okotoks' local energy infrastructure, route design, fleet requirements, and cost modeling to determine the best-fit electrification strategies. Attendees will learn: The methodology used to assess Okotoks’ readiness for zero-emission transit Key findings and recommendations from the feasibility report Insights into fleet transition planning, energy demand forecasting, and cost-benefit analysis How lessons from Okotoks can be scaled or adapted for similar municipalities This session is ideal for municipal leaders, planners, and engineers looking to build a practical path to electrification.
